Understanding the Hacking Landscape

Hackers employ various tactics to gain unauthorized access to Facebook accounts. These include phishing scams, malware infections, and weak passwords. Understanding these methods can help you proactively protect your account in the future.

Common Hacking Tactics

  • Phishing scams: Fake emails or messages designed to trick you into revealing your login credentials.
  • Malware infections: Malicious software installed on your device that steals your login information.
  • Weak passwords: Easily guessable or reused passwords across multiple platforms.
  • Social engineering: Manipulating you into divulging personal information through deceptive tactics.

Steps to Recover Your Hacked Account

The first step in recovering your account is to act quickly. Delay can often make the recovery process more challenging.

1. Verify Your Account

If you suspect your account has been compromised, immediately log out of all devices and change your Facebook password. This is crucial to prevent further unauthorized access.

2. Initiate the Recovery Process

Facebook provides a dedicated account recovery section on its website. Follow the prompts carefully, providing as much information as possible to help Facebook verify your identity.

3. Provide Supporting Evidence

Facebook may request supporting evidence to confirm your identity. This might include:

  • Email addresses associated with your account.
  • Phone numbers linked to your account.
  • Security questions you previously answered.
  • Recent activity logs.

4. Address Security Issues

Once your account is recovered, it's vital to strengthen your security measures. This includes:

  • Creating a strong password: Use a unique password that's difficult to guess.
  • Enabling two-factor authentication (2FA): This adds an extra layer of security by requiring a code from your phone or another device in addition to your password.
  • Reviewing your app permissions: Ensure that only trusted apps have access to your account.
